Eicosapentaenoic acid reduces pain by inhibiting vesicular nucleotide transporter-mediated ATP release (IMAGE)
Caption
New study identifies vesicular nucleotide transporter as a novel target of eicosapentaenoic acid (EPA) and highlights the mechanism underlying the analgesic effect of EPA. EPA potently attenuates neuropathic and inflammatory pain and insulin resistance, with fewer side effects
